What is a property mutation?
Property mutation is the process of altering ownership information in government land records when a property has been sold, inherited, or transferred by gift or lease. While it does not prove ownership on its own, it helps ensure that official records show the correct owner.
This step is critical for keeping property tax records current (ensuring that tax bills are sent to the correct person), maintaining legal clarity, and avoiding difficulties in future property transactions.
What does the property mutation portal provide?
The property mutation site allows for end-to-end online update of ownership records, eliminating the need to visit Tehsildar offices. The National Informatics Centre (NIC) in Pune created the portal.
(epsitmumc.mahabhumi.gov.in) provides a unified platform for accessing mutation services.
The key elements of the gateway include:
Covers 45 types of property transactions, including inheritance, purchase, lease, mortgage, and others.
Complete online process, including application submission and document upload.
Zero physical interface, eliminating the need for lineups and office visits.
Real-time tracking with SMS notifications and login-based status updates.
A dedicated login-based dashboard that enables for 24/7 application monitoring.
The portal’s features improve the efficiency and transparency of a previously manual procedure. While the system is totally automated, a real help desk has been set up at the Mumbai City Collector’s office to assist applicants who encounter problems.
Note: The portal is now limited to the Mumbai City Area, although it is expected to progressively expand to suburban areas and other regions.
Key advantages for homebuyers and property owners in Mumbai
For homebuyers and property owners, this digital mutation site tackles various long-standing issues with post-purchase requirements. By eliminating the need for physical trips to Tehsildar and revenue offices, it minimizes reliance on manual processes and intermediaries, making the overall experience more streamlined.
The online method is also expected to allow for faster processing of ownership changes while reducing paperwork and delays. Simultaneously, real-time tracking keeps applicants up to date on the status of their applications, increasing transparency throughout the process.
The ability to finish the process digitally provides NRIs and remote property owners with a level of convenience that was previously difficult to attain. Overall, this move simplifies one of the most time-consuming tasks after purchasing a home.
